Magnesium and Synaptic Efficiency

Synaptic efficiency — how cleanly and precisely signals transmit between neurons — determines the quality of thinking. Magnesium is the gatekeeper of NMDA receptors, the synaptic channels most critical for learning, memory formation, and the integration of information across brain regions. Well-regulated NMDA function (supported by adequate magnesium) allows the brain to process information with precision and speed, while poorly regulated function (in magnesium deficiency) produces fuzzy thinking, poor recall, and mental fatigue.

Selenium and Neural Protection

Neurons are among the most metabolically active and most oxidatively vulnerable cells in the body. Selenium, present in ocean minerals, is a critical cofactor for glutathione peroxidase — the primary antioxidant enzyme that protects neural tissue from the oxidative damage of intense cognitive work. Adequate selenium status is associated with faster processing speed and better cognitive resilience under sustained mental effort.
